Skip to main content
The Dashboard (/app/dashboard) is your per-business command center. After you pick a client in Business Space (top-left), you see a widget-based layout that rolls up Meta spend, GoHighLevel pipeline activity, and revenue for the selected date range. Open it from Operations → Dashboard in the left sidebar.
New to the product? Start with Add a business, then Connect Facebook and Connect GoHighLevel so KPI widgets populate.

Page layout

AreaWhat it does
Dashboard name (top-left)Shows the active saved layout (for example Default). Click to open Manage dashboards — switch, duplicate, set default, or copy to other businesses.
Edit layoutEnters layout mode: drag widgets, resize, add/remove, rename the dashboard. Save with Save or Ctrl+S / ⌘+S. See Customize your layout.
Date rangeFilters every widget. Default is roughly the last 8 days ending yesterday. Changing dates shows Updating… while data refreshes; you can still change the range during load.
Filter funnelsLimits metrics to one or more GHL funnels. All funnels are selected by default when the list loads or when you change dates. A 2/4 badge appears when you narrow the selection.
Widget gridYour KPI cards, charts, and tables. Layout is per dashboard and per business.

Filter funnels

Funnel filtering splits Facebook spend proportionally by lead share and splits GHL metrics across funnels on each ad. Use it when one ad account runs multiple offers.
  1. Open Filter Funnels.
  2. Uncheck funnels you want to exclude (or use Select all to reset to every funnel in range).
  3. Metrics and charts update for the remaining funnels only.
If the control is disabled, widen the date range or confirm funnels exist in Settings → Funnels. The menu explains when no funnels have data in the selected window.

Key metrics widget

The Key metrics widget is the full-width summary row. Default metrics often include Spend, Revenue, Leads, CPL, Calls, and Closes — you can change which cards appear in widget settings.
MetricTypical meaning
SpendMeta ad spend for the period
Cash collected / Contract valueMapped in GHL Revenue Settings
FE ROAS / ROASCash or contract value ÷ spend
Qualified leadsLeads after lead qualification rules
CallsSelf-booked, marketing-attributed calls (see metric info icons in-app)
CPL / CPQL / CPBC / CPQBCCost ratios vs leads, qualified leads, or calls

Target coloring

When targets exist in Settings → KPIs & Budget, cards show on-target / over-target states. Hover the info icon on a metric for the formula and target.

Drill into records

Many metrics are clickable — they open CRM lists for the same date window (for example Calls → Calls tab, Qualified leads → Leads, Closes → Sales). Use this to audit any headline number.

Other widgets

WidgetUse case
ReportLine, bar, area, pie, or polar chart for metrics you choose
Period compareCurrent period vs previous period (same length), auto-rotating slides
Best performing adsLeaderboard by KPI (spend, CPL, etc.)
Attribution & geoGHL placement (utm_term) or Meta placement breakdown
Full reference: Dashboard widgets.

Common workflows

Morning client check

  1. Select the business in Business Space.
  2. Confirm the date range (often last 7 days).
  3. Scan Key metrics for red/over-target cards.
  4. Open Ads Manager for the campaign behind a bad CPL or CPBC.

Isolate one offer

  1. Open Filter Funnels and leave only that funnel checked.
  2. Compare spend, leads, and revenue without other offers diluting the view.

Build a client-specific view

  1. Click Edit layoutAdd widget.
  2. Drag widgets into place and resize corners.
  3. Save — name the dashboard in layout mode if needed.
  4. Optional: Manage dashboards → push visible to client for the client portal.

Verify a KPI

  1. Click the metric card (when drilldown is available).
  2. Cross-check row count vs the dashboard value.
  3. If qualification looks wrong, fix rules under Settings → GoHighLevel.

Permissions

ActionTypical permission
View dashboardreports.view (and business access)
Create / edit layoutsdashboard.create
Delete dashboardsdashboard.delete
Global template dashboards (badge Global) are read-only — duplicate into the business to customize.

Customize layout

Edit mode, save, multiple dashboards, client visibility.

Widget reference

Every widget type and settings.

Ads Manager

Campaign-level drill-down from dashboard signals.

All Accounts

Compare KPIs across every business in one table.